A disciple of Fernando Ortiz, Miguel Barnet makes an important contribution to the ethnographic literature of the Caribbean with this work, which has received international acclaim. In this biography, Esteban Montejo, a slave who managed to escape from the clutches of the odious "peculiar" institution, recounts his life and describes, perhaps without realizing it, Cuban society at the end of the 19th century and the beginning of the 20th century. A work of enormous importance to understand the cultural subtleties of the Hispanic Caribbean.
